Strategies for Reducing Noise and Distractions
Creating tranquility at home often begins with reducing noise and distractions that can disrupt family life. Here are some practical strategies to achieve this.
Soundproofing Spaces: Invest in soundproofing techniques, such as adding thick curtains, carpeting, or acoustic panels. These materials help absorb sound, minimizing disturbances.
Organized Spaces: Keeping a tidy environment can significantly decrease mental clutter. Designate specific areas for activities; this organization helps maintain focus and reduces unnecessary distractions.
Limit Digital Disturbances: Set boundaries around technology usage. Establish times when devices are silenced or put away, fostering a calm atmosphere that encourages face-to-face interactions.
Create Quiet Zones: Designate areas in your home as quiet zones where family members can retreat for relaxation or concentration. Populate these spaces with comfortable seating and calming decor to reinforce their purpose.
Mindful Activities: Engage in family activities that promote mindfulness, such as reading or puzzles, which can naturally minimize noise and bring a sense of calm.
Implementing these strategies can significantly contribute to creating a serene home that prioritizes tranquility and organization, enhancing the overall well-being of your family.
Incorporating Nature and Comfort in Your Living Space
Introducing elements from nature into your home can greatly enhance tranquility and create peaceful spaces for your family. Consider adding houseplants not only for their beauty but also for their potential to improve air quality and foster a calming atmosphere. Choose plants that are easy to care for, such as peace lilies or snake plants, to ensure that maintaining them adds to your sense of organization rather than stress.
Incorporating natural materials like wood, stone, and cotton can further establish a connection to the outdoors. Furniture made from sustainable resources offers both comfort and warmth, while organic fabrics in your décor promote a cozy environment. The textures and colors found in nature can inspire a palette that soothes the mind and creates a more inviting living area.
Designating specific areas for relaxation, such as a reading nook with natural light, can also enhance your home’s comfort. Utilize soft furnishings and gentle colors to make these spots feel inviting and nurturing. Establishing Daily Routines to Foster Serenity
Creating a tranquil atmosphere at home can be significantly enhanced through well-structured daily routines. Organization plays a fundamental role in minimizing chaos and promoting intentional living. By establishing predictable patterns, family members can feel more secure and grounded.
Here are several ways to incorporate routines that enhance peaceful spaces:
- Mornings: Begin the day with calm rituals such as meditation or gentle stretching, allowing everyone to start the day with clarity.
- Meal Times: Designate regular times for meals. Enjoying food together can create bonds and provide a sense of stability.
- Chores: Assign daily chores to each family member. This fosters a sense of responsibility and keeps the home organized.
- Tech-Free Time: Establish specific hours during the day where screens are turned off. This encourages deeper connections and minimizes distractions.
- Night Routines: Create calming pre-sleep activities, like reading or soft music, to signal the transition to rest.
Implementing these routines can lead to a more peaceful home, where each family member feels valued and supported. The structure not only encourages harmony but also reinforces the importance of creating a balanced lifestyle.
